Coca-Cola, New Jersey’s Lieutenant Governor and the WNBA Salute Active, Healthy Females at Sandy Hook’s Annual All-Women Lifeguard Tournament
New York, July 22, 2011 – This summer, Coca-Cola is proud to support parks all across the country – America’s Playgrounds – and one of these playgrounds is right in your backyard! Come outside and enjoy the season at one of New Jersey’s beautiful parks, Sandy Hook – Gateway National Recreation Area as we kick-off Coca-Cola’s America Is Your Park (AIYP) regional campaign at the All-Women Lifeguard Tournament in conjunction with the National Park Service.

About America Is Your Park
From June 29, 2011 to September 6, 2011, people can go to www.LivePositively.com to cast a vote for their favorite park. Individuals can vote in the following ways: click on their favorite park and vote, upload photos of themselves in their favorite park or “check in” from the park using Facebook Places.
